KERES, proper noun. (Greek god) The goddesses of death, (specifically cruel and violent deaths, including death in battle, by accident, murder or ravaging disease); they numbered in the thousands and were the daughters of Nyx and Erebus, and the sisters of Thanatos and Hypnos. Their Roman counterparts were the Letum or the Tenebrae.
